Here is a real nice natural stained Texan I just purchased. I think I got the deal of the Century on this. The face profile seems a lot different than most I've ever seen, very very similiar to the shape and depth of a M85W. It has a graphite shaft right now, which I most likely will switch out for a steel shaft. This is the only one I have that has the "WB" on the skirt.

I spoke to Dave about this one. I got it from somebody else. He told me..: (btw- No he is not..)

I would suggest very carefully pulling the shaft.
1. Use a heat gun with slow and gradual heating to not pop, or burn the finish and leave the whipping on to support the neck from not cracking.

2. Clean out the hosel with a slow speed tapered reamer, or better yet, use a round file.

3.Check the head weight. If heavy you might think about lighter weight steel, or do some counter balancing in the butt section (Nicklaus always did this).

4. Measure the profile of the removed shafts tip dimensions with caliper or micrometer. At WB we used reduced tip graphite shafts, they were parallel but emulated taper tip. This will tell you whether or not the neck needs to be reamed for a tapered steel shaft.

Drew and Astaam,
Here is what Dave Wood just told me about your drivers..
(Drew, btw.. will send Dave the pic of the top of yours to show him the grain, to verify what he says about the "U")

Hi Fred,

No problem, its interesting and great to see.

The Blonde with the white insert is very interesting. It looks a lot like a few Drivers that I made up for Hal Sutton. Hal was a big fan of both Byron Nelson and Jimmy Demaret. He liked the shape and deepness of an old Nelson 4393 that he had. Also, I had a set on display of Demaret 693's with a 4 screw white insert and opaque maroon finish (one of a kind- Mr. D loved flash). Hal liked the white 4 screw.

We agreed to combine features from both, to make up a model of his own. Being blonde, highly visible and golf's golden boy at the time, I made a few of his clubs with the blonde finish. Can't really see from the picture, but I'll bet the grain is an outstanding and tight U (he also liked a little carbon). Also, notice the insert channel is routed more vertically on the toe and angled slightly forward on the face, I did this to make the club appear more upright in his address position. The face also has a few extra scoring lines, this look came from his Nelson. I'm not saying for sure that it's one of Hal's Texan's, but it looks terribly suspicious... Would love to refinish it.

Fred, the Driver with the red fiber 4 screw, would also be a custom make up. But it would not be one of Norman's as Greg loved the oil hardened stamp with the Texas tower. In the picture, the heel side sole shape appears more rounded, like your Langer driver.

This wood also shows a brass Texas sole plate with no loft designation on it. Brass plates were occasionally used when a player wanted a lower CG for dual purpose use from off the fairway. Also, when someone chose a particular block and shape, but wanted the club built out with a light weight graphite shaft. It is possible that this particular head may have had a graphite shaft in it. Only judging by the photo, I don't feel the current shaft in it, is the original.

All the best

Dave
